atwiki-logo
  • 新規作成
    • 新規ページ作成
    • 新規ページ作成(その他)
      • このページをコピーして新規ページ作成
      • このウィキ内の別ページをコピーして新規ページ作成
      • このページの子ページを作成
    • 新規ウィキ作成
  • 編集
    • ページ編集
    • ページ編集(簡易版)
    • ページ名変更
    • メニュー非表示でページ編集
    • ページの閲覧/編集権限変更
    • ページの編集モード変更
    • このページにファイルをアップロード
    • メニューを編集
    • 右メニューを編集
  • バージョン管理
    • 最新版変更点(差分)
    • 編集履歴(バックアップ)
    • アップロードファイル履歴
    • このページの操作履歴
    • このウィキのページ操作履歴
  • ページ一覧
    • ページ一覧
    • このウィキのタグ一覧
    • このウィキのタグ(更新順)
    • このページの全コメント一覧
    • このウィキの全コメント一覧
    • おまかせページ移動
  • RSS
    • このウィキの更新情報RSS
    • このウィキ新着ページRSS
  • ヘルプ
    • ご利用ガイド
    • Wiki初心者向けガイド(基本操作)
    • このウィキの管理者に連絡
    • 運営会社に連絡(不具合、障害など)
ページ検索 メニュー
unixspec @ ウィキ
  • 広告なしオファー
  • ウィキ募集バナー
  • 目安箱バナー
  • 操作ガイド
  • 新規作成
  • 編集する
  • 全ページ一覧
  • 登録/ログイン
広告非表示(β版)
ページ一覧
unixspec @ ウィキ
  • 広告なしオファー
  • ウィキ募集バナー
  • 目安箱バナー
  • 操作ガイド
  • 新規作成
  • 編集する
  • 全ページ一覧
  • 登録/ログイン
ページ一覧
unixspec @ ウィキ
広告非表示 広告非表示(β)版 ページ検索 ページ検索 メニュー メニュー
  • 新規作成
  • 編集する
  • 登録/ログイン
  • 管理メニュー
管理メニュー
  • 新規作成
    • 新規ページ作成
    • 新規ページ作成(その他)
      • このページをコピーして新規ページ作成
      • このウィキ内の別ページをコピーして新規ページ作成
      • このページの子ページを作成
    • 新規ウィキ作成
  • 編集
    • ページ編集
    • ページ編集(簡易版)
    • ページ名変更
    • メニュー非表示でページ編集
    • ページの閲覧/編集権限変更
    • ページの編集モード変更
    • このページにファイルをアップロード
    • メニューを編集
    • 右メニューを編集
  • バージョン管理
    • 最新版変更点(差分)
    • 編集履歴(バックアップ)
    • アップロードファイル履歴
    • このページの操作履歴
    • このウィキのページ操作履歴
  • ページ一覧
    • このウィキの全ページ一覧
    • このウィキのタグ一覧
    • このウィキのタグ一覧(更新順)
    • このページの全コメント一覧
    • このウィキの全コメント一覧
    • おまかせページ移動
  • RSS
    • このwikiの更新情報RSS
    • このwikiの新着ページRSS
  • ヘルプ
    • ご利用ガイド
    • Wiki初心者向けガイド(基本操作)
    • このウィキの管理者に連絡
    • 運営会社に連絡する(不具合、障害など)
  • atwiki
  • unixspec @ ウィキ
  • more

unixspec @ ウィキ

more

最終更新:2012年01月03日 15:39

unixspec

- view
メンバー限定 登録/ログイン
名前
more - ページ毎にファイルを表示する
概要
more [-ceisu][-n number][-p command][-t tagstring][file ...]
説明
moreユーティリティは、ファイルから読み込んだ後に、それをターミナルへページ毎に書きだすか、又はフィルタリングして標準出力に書き出す。もしも標準出力がターミナルデバイスで無ければ、すべての入力ファイルは標準出力にそっくりそのままコピーされる。-sオプションを除けば、変更は加えられない。
いくつかのブロックモードのターミナルは完全なmoreの定義に沿うのに必要な能力が備わっていない;<newline>で終わらないコマンドを受け付ける能力がない。それらのターミナルについては、全てのコマンドが<newline>で終わる事が出来るオペレーティングモードをmoreに提供するというようなサポートを実装せよ。このモードは
  • そのシステムのドキュメントにドキュメント化せよ。
  • 呼び出された時に、ターミナルの能力不足によって<newline>が必要である旨の使用方法の通知をし、この警告通知をどのようにしたら永久に表示しないように出来るか、その方法についての導入を提供せよ。
  • 十分な能力のあるターミナルにのみ実装は要求されない。
  • 既に<newline>を要求するコマンドには影響を及びさない。
  • 十分な能力のあるターミナル上でIEEE Std 1003.1-2001で説明されているようなmoreを用いるユーザーには影響を及びさない。
オプション
moreユーティリティはBase Definitions volume of IEEE Std 1003.1-2001, Section 12.2, Utility Syntax Guidelinesに従う。
次に挙げるオプションがサポートされている。
-c
もしも画面に何も書かれていなかったか、又はmoreが最初に画面に書く時には、moreは画面をスクロールしない。その代わりに、画面のすべての行を再描画する。それに加え、moreが最初に画面に書く時には、画面は初期化される。このオプションは、ターミナルが能力不足である場合にはエラーを吐かずにデバイスによって無視される。
-e
デフォルト。moreは引数リストの最後のファイルの最後の行を書いた後、すぐに終了する。もしも-eオプションが定義されていた時には
  1. もしも引数リストにファイルがただ一つ存在して、かつ一つの画面にそのファイルが完全に表示された時には、moreはそのファイルの最終行が書かれた直後に終了する。
  2. その他の場合、moreは、操作の介在なしに引数リストの最後のファイルでファイルの終端に達した時に終了する。補足説明を見よ。
-i
文字の大小を無視してパターンマッチを行う。Base Definitions volume of IEEE Std 1003.1-2001, Section 9.2, Regular Expression General Requirementsを見よ。
-n number
画面の行数を定義する。number引数は正の整数である。-nオプションは他の場所から得られる値を上書きする。
-p command
新しいファイルが表示(又は再表示)された時(moreのコマンドの結果を含む。例えば、:p)、最初に画面に表示された後にユーザがコマンドを入力したかのようにmoreは引数によって定義されるコマンドを実行する。中間結果が表示されることはない(例えば、コマンドが通常の最初の画面から別の画面への移動であれば、コマンドの結果のみを画面に表示されなければならない)。コマンドが失敗した時、そのコマンドの効果に関する情報を与えるメッセージが画面に書かれ、-pオプションによって定義されたコマンドは、そのファイルから実行されない。
-s
連続した空行が1行であったかのように振る舞う。
-t tagstring
tagstring引数によってタグ付けされたファイルを表示する。ctagsユーティリティを見よ。タグは-t tagstring及び&b{:t}コマンドによって表される。これはctagsが実装されて提供される全てのシステム上で提供される。その他の場合には、-tは未定義の結果を引き起こす。
-tオプションによって得られるファイル名は、ユーザが定義したかのようにコマンドラインのファイルリストの前に論理的に付加される。もしもtagstring引数によって名付けられたタグが存在しなければ、エラーを引き起こし、moreはその他の行動を起こさない。
もしも行番号によってタグが定義されていれば、最初に表示される画面の最初の行はその行を含む。タグがパターンによって定義されていれば、そのファイルの、パターンにマッチする最初の行を最初に表示される画面の最初の行は含む。もしパターンにマッチする行が存在しなければ、そのコマンドの効果に関する情報を与えるメッセージが画面に書かれ、moreは、-tが使用されなかったかのように標準の画面に描画する。
-t tagstringと-p commandが同時に与えられた時、-t tagstringが最初に実行される。つまり、ファイルと画面に表示される最初の行は-tによって決められて、その後にmoreの-pコマンドが実行される。もしも-tコマンドによって定義される該当行が存在しなければ(マッチするテキストが見つからなければ)、-pコマンドはこのファイルからずっと実行されない。
-u
<backspace>を表示可能な文字とみなす。実装依存の文字列が表示される(補足説明を見よ)。幾つかの端末は、バックスペースと、下線や強調表示モード等を生成する特殊な処理を抑制する。又、行末の<carriage-return>を無視しない。
オペランド
次に挙げるオペランドがサポートされている。
file
入力ファイルへのパス名。もしこの引数が存在しないときには、標準入力が使われる。この引数が'-'の時には、標準入力は必要な所まで読まれる。
標準入力
標準入力は、file引数が存在せず、又は'-'が引数として指定された時のみに使用される。
入力ファイル
走査中の入力ファイルはテキストファイルであるべきである。もしも標準出力がターミナルであれば、標準エラー出力はユーザからコマンドを読み込む為に使われる。もしも標準出力がターミナルであれば、標準エラー出力からは読み込めず、コマンド入力が必要である。moreは操作中のターミナルからユーザのコマンドを得ることを試みる(例えば、/dev/tty)しかしながら、moreはユーザのコマンドを読み込めない時にはエラーを示しながら終了する。もしも標準出力がターミナルでなく、かつ標準エラー出力を読み込み用に開くことが出来なければ、エラーは返らない。
環境変数
次に挙げる環境変数が、moreの実行時に影響を及ぼす。
COLUMNS
(writing...)
EDITOR
(writing...)
LANG
セットされていない、又は空である国際化変数(Internationalization Variables)のデフォルト値を規定する(ローケルの分類を決める値として使われる国際化変数を知るためには、Base Definitions volume of IEEE Std 1003.1-2001, Section 8.2, Internationalization Variablesを見よ)。
LC_ALL
空でない文字列がセットされていたときには、他の全ての国際化変数の値としてこの値を用いる。
LC_COLLATE
(writing...)
LC_CTYPE
テキストデータのバイトの並びを文字列として解釈するためのロケールを決定する。
LC_MESSAGES
標準エラー出力に書かれる診断メッセージの内容と形式に影響を与える為に用いられるロケールを決定する。
NLSPATH
LC_MESSAGESの処理の際に、メッセージの分類の位置を決める。
LINES
(writing...)
MORE
(writing...)
TERM
(writing...)
非同期のイベント
デフォルト
標準出力
標準出力は入力ファイルの内容を書くために使われる。
標準エラー出力
(writing...)
出力ファイル
無し
補足説明
(writing...)
終了ステータス
次に挙げる終了ステータスが返される。
0
全ての入力ファイルは正常に出力された。
&gt;0
エラーが発生した。
エラーの影響
(writing...)

(writing ...)

参照
Shell Command Language, ctags, ed, ex, vi
「more」をウィキ内検索
LINE
シェア
Tweet
unixspec @ ウィキ
記事メニュー

メニュー

  • トップページ
  • このwikiのページ一覧
ここを編集

permission from The Open Group.
記事メニュー2

更新履歴

取得中です。


ここを編集
最近更新されたページ
  • 5062日前

    more
  • 5064日前

    メニュー
  • 5064日前

    Single Unix Specification V3 勝手に翻訳@wiki
  • 5065日前

    cat
  • 5065日前

    右メニュー
もっと見る
最近更新されたページ
  • 5062日前

    more
  • 5064日前

    メニュー
  • 5064日前

    Single Unix Specification V3 勝手に翻訳@wiki
  • 5065日前

    cat
  • 5065日前

    右メニュー
もっと見る
ウィキ募集バナー
急上昇Wikiランキング

急上昇中のWikiランキングです。今注目を集めている話題をチェックしてみよう!

  1. 遊戯王DSNTナイトメアトラバドール攻略Wiki@わかな
  2. デジタルモンスター まとめ@ ウィキ
  3. Last Z: Survival Shooter @ ウィキ
  4. GUNDAM WAR Wiki
  5. ホワイトハッカー研究所
  6. オバマス検証@wiki
  7. アニヲタWiki(仮)
  8. とある魔術の禁書目録 Index
  9. MADTOWNGTAまとめwiki
  10. beatmania IIDX SP攻略 @ wiki
もっと見る
人気Wikiランキング

atwikiでよく見られているWikiのランキングです。新しい情報を発見してみよう!

  1. アニヲタWiki(仮)
  2. ゲームカタログ@Wiki ~名作からクソゲーまで~
  3. 初音ミク Wiki
  4. ストグラ まとめ @ウィキ
  5. MADTOWNGTAまとめwiki
  6. 機動戦士ガンダム EXTREME VS.2 INFINITEBOOST wiki
  7. 機動戦士ガンダム バトルオペレーション2攻略Wiki 3rd Season
  8. 検索してはいけない言葉 @ ウィキ
  9. Grand Theft Auto V(グランドセフトオート5)GTA5 & GTAオンライン 情報・攻略wiki
  10. 英傑大戦wiki
もっと見る
新規Wikiランキング

最近作成されたWikiのアクセスランキングです。見るだけでなく加筆してみよう!

  1. フォートナイト攻略Wiki
  2. MADTOWNGTAまとめwiki
  3. MadTown GTA (Beta) まとめウィキ
  4. 首都圏駅メロwiki
  5. Last Z: Survival Shooter @ ウィキ
  6. まどドラ攻略wiki
  7. 駅のスピーカーwiki
  8. 漢字でGO 問題集 @wiki
  9. ちいぽけ攻略
  10. 魔法少女ノ魔女裁判 攻略・考察Wiki
もっと見る
全体ページランキング

最近アクセスの多かったページランキングです。話題のページを見に行こう!

  1. 【移転】Miss AV 見れない Missav.wsが見れない?!MissAV新URLはどこ?閉鎖・終了してない?missav.ai元気玉って何? - ホワイトハッカー研究所
  2. ブラック・マジシャン・ガール - 遊戯王DSNTナイトメアトラバドール攻略Wiki@わかな
  3. 真崎杏子 - 遊戯王DSNTナイトメアトラバドール攻略Wiki@わかな
  4. 魔獣トゲイラ - バトルロイヤルR+α ファンフィクション(二次創作など)総合wiki
  5. ブラック・マジシャン・ガール - アニヲタWiki(仮)
  6. ゴジュウユニコーン/一河角乃 - アニヲタWiki(仮)
  7. 参加者一覧 - ストグラ まとめ @ウィキ
  8. 参加者一覧 - MADTOWNGTAまとめwiki
  9. Pokémon LEGENDS Z-A - アニヲタWiki(仮)
  10. 辻 伸弘(NTTデータ先端技術株式会社) - IT人材像 @ ウィキ
もっと見る

  • このWikiのTOPへ
  • 全ページ一覧
  • アットウィキTOP
  • 利用規約
  • プライバシーポリシー

2019 AtWiki, Inc.